What are Polynucleotides?

Polynucleotides are chains of long nucleotides, the DNA and RNA building blocks, essential for everyday functions. 

They are involved in the function of cells, such as cellular repair and regeneration. Synthetic polynucleotides are used for their regenerative properties in aesthetics, usually taken from salmon sperm or other marine organisms to help with skin rejuvenation and the overall quality of your skin.

Microneedling

One case study reported the use of microneedling in conjunction with the application of a polynucleotide-rich serum, resulting in improved skin texture, reduced appearance of acne scars, and enhanced collagen production (Singh & Yadav, 2016).

Injectable Therapies

A case series demonstrated the effectiveness of polynucleotide-based injections in the treatment of acne scars, with significant improvements in scar appearance and skin texture (Kim et al, 2023).

Integrating Polynucleotides into Existing Protocols 

For aesthetic practitioners interested in incorporating polynucleotide treatments, it’s essential to consider training, equipment needs, and potential collaborations with institutions like Acquisition Aesthetics UK and/or biotechnology firms that provide polynucleotide injectable products/equipment. Proper integration ensures that treatments are performed safely and effectively, maximising patient outcomes.

Training and Certification: As polynucleotides represent a relatively new frontier in aesthetic medicine, aesthetic practitioners must undergo specialised training to understand the science behind these treatments, proper injection techniques, and safety protocols. Certification ensures that practitioners are equipped with the necessary skills and knowledge to deliver treatments effectively and safely.

Equipment and Product Selection: Incorporating polynucleotides may require specific equipment or tools, depending on the treatment modality. Practitioners should assess their current setup and determine whether additional investments in equipment or technology are needed. Additionally, selecting the right polynucleotide product is critical, as different products may vary in concentration, formulation, and intended use.

Collaboration with Biotechnology Firms: Collaborating with biotechnology firms can provide practitioners with access to the latest advancements in polynucleotide technology, ongoing support, and potentially exclusive product offerings. These partnerships can also facilitate participation in clinical trials or research studies, allowing practitioners to stay at the forefront of the field.

Patient Education and Protocol Development: Practitioners need to educate patients about the benefits and limitations of polynucleotide treatments. Developing comprehensive treatment protocols that include pre-treatment assessment, post-treatment care, and follow-up is essential to ensure consistency and maximise patient satisfaction.

1. Are polynucleotide treatments safe? 

Yes, polynucleotide treatments are generally considered safe when administered by trained professionals. Polynucleotides are naturally occurring substances, and synthetic versions are designed to mimic these biological compounds. Side effects are typically minimal and may include temporary redness, swelling, or bruising at the treatment site. It is important for practitioners to follow proper protocols and for patients to undergo a thorough consultation to ensure suitability for the treatment. 2. How do polynucleotides compare to other anti-ageing treatments? 

Polynucleotides offer unique advantages over other anti-aging treatments:

  • Natural Mechanism: Unlike some synthetic treatments, polynucleotides work by enhancing the body’s natural regenerative processes.
  • Long-Lasting Results: The improvements from polynucleotide treatments tend to develop gradually and can last longer, as they promote deep cellular repair.
  • Complementary Use: Polynucleotide treatments can be used alongside other aesthetic procedures, such as fillers and lasers, to enhance overall results.
  • Low Risk of Allergic Reactions: Since polynucleotides are similar to the body’s own molecules, they have a lower risk of causing allergic reactions.

3. What should patients expect during a polynucleotide treatment? 

Patients can expect a straightforward and minimally invasive procedure. The process begins with a consultation to assess the patient’s skin condition and aesthetic goals. During the treatment, polynucleotides are administered through injectables, microneedling, or topical application, depending on the chosen procedure. Recovery time is usually minimal, with patients often returning to normal activities shortly after the treatment. Some mild redness or swelling may occur, but this typically subsides within a few hours to days.

Note: Results are not immediate but develop gradually as the polynucleotides stimulate cellular repair and regeneration. Patients may notice improved skin texture, elasticity, and overall appearance within a few weeks.
